From the Lowcountry to the Capitol

Three local students represented Palmetto Electric Cooperative on the 2026 Washington Youth Tour that took place on June 14-19. Alexander Burnett of Hilton Head Island Preparatory School, Addison White of Bluffton High School, and Sophie Olander of Hilton Head Island High School earned the opportunity to participate in the six-day experience in Washington, D.C.

The Washington Youth Tour brings together high school rising seniors from across the country to learn about government, leadership, and the cooperative business model while visiting some of the nation's most historic landmarks.

Adding to the excitement, Alexander Burnett was selected to serve on the Board of Trustees of the student-run “Soda Pop Co-op,” where participants gain hands-on experience in learning the cooperative business model.

Palmetto Electric also congratulates Jake Holland, son of Palmetto Electric Board Member Alicia Holland, who was selected to represent The Electric Cooperatives of South Carolina on this year's Washington Youth Tour.

We are proud of these young leaders for representing our cooperative, our communities, and the cooperative spirit in our nation's capital. Through this experience, they are building leadership skills, forming lifelong friendships, and creating memories that will last them a lifetime.

 

WYT participants 2026
Pictured left to right: Alexander Burnett, Sophie Olander, Addison White, and Jake Holland.
